Rainwater outlets
With conventional roofing products it is very difficult to detail and
waterproof these areas. With Flexstone HAE it's simple – the outlet grille is
removed to allow the coating to be applied down into the rainwater outlet,
then reinstated.
Parapet walls
To prevent water from entering the building where walls and roofs meet, a
chase is conventionally cut in the brickwork into which the coating system is
inserted and sealed (an alternative method is to fix and seal a termination bar
over the coating termination). Rainwater runs down the wall, via the upstand
coating detail and onto the protected roof.
Vents and pipes
Any penetration through the existing roof membrane is a potential area for
water ingress into the building. The Flexstone HAE coating system can be
seamlessly applied to pipes and protrusions, protecting against such
vulnerabilities.
Rooflights
The Flexstone HAE system can seamlessly incorporate rooflights, providing a
waterproof, continuous membrane. During installation, rooflights are removed
(wherever possible) to allow the coating to be applied to the upstand and opening.
B - Inverted Roofs / Podium / Green Roofs
Flexstone HAE system, when installed directly onto the structural deck, has an unrivaled track record for long term waterproofing of inverted and green roofs as well as complex and prestigious podium.
In this construction the thermal insulation is applied on top of the
structural waterproofing. This type of system is often referred to
as a ‘protected membrane’, or ‘upside down’ roof. Like the
Flexstone HAE warm roof system, the inverted system helps
lower energy costs by reducing heat loss from the roof.
Flexstone HAE provides structural waterproofing below the
insulation layer and directly over the existing roof substrate. Its
seamless nature provides maximum protection and offers
significant advantages over sheet and partially bonded systems.
This system is usually finished with paving materials to provide
an attractive appearance. This solution is ideal for roof terraces
and balconies and will withstand heavy foot traffic. Alternatively,
inverted roofs can be utilised with seedum banks to create green
roofs or roof gardens.
The system also fully upgrades the thermal performance of the
roof, which means building owners can comply with Part L of the
Building Regulations (Conservation of Heat & Power).

Rainwater outlets
Where the roofing system meets rainwater outlets a stainless steel
guard is fitted around the rainwater outlet cover. The thermal
insulation and paving is shaped and offered up to the guard.
Alternatively, ballast can be used to fill in the gap details.
Vents and pipes
The Flexstone HAE waterproofing system is continued up the pipe
to give a termination of at least 150mm above the finished height of
the overall assembly. A clip / tie is fitted to the pipe around the
coating termination. This is then finished with a flexible sealant
Expansion joints
Prior to application of the Flexstone HAE system, the gap of the
expansion joint is sealed by the insertion of a backer rod followed by
application of a flexible mastic sealant. To allow for movement, a
bridging tape (nominally 50-100mm wide) is applied along the line
of the joint.
Parapet walls
The Flexstone HAE waterproofing system is taken a minimum
of 150mm above the overall assembly and either terminated into
a precut chase or protected with a termination bar.
